Kenya now requires an Electronic Travel Authorisation (ETA) for most travellers, which replaces the previous visa requirement. To obtain an ETA, travellers need to apply online at https://www.etakenya.go.ke/en/evisa.html at least 72 hours before travel. Key requirements include a valid passport (with at least 6 months validity remaining), a recent passport-sized photo, and proof of accommodation (hotel booking or host information).

Choose the correct visa, such as tourist, business, or transit, based on your purpose of visit.
Apply through Kenya's official eVisa portal, ensuring all required documents are ready, like a passport and photo.
Complete the visa application form carefully, providing accurate personal and travel details.
Make secure payment for the visa fee using the available online payment options.
After approval, download and print your eVisa to present at immigration upon arrival in Kenya.
